If so, you might be the right person to do Information Security at St. Olaf
and Carleton Colleges in Northfield, MN – the sole Information Security
staffer at the colleges and the expert with paramount responsibility for
providing a safe, secure computing environment for 6,600 students, faculty
and staff.

More specifically, you would wrestle with all the issues of contemporary
information security – multiplying threats, varied solutions, evolving
software and hardware, new skills and methods. We expect that you will
spend about a third of the workweek on information security infrastructure,
a third on pro-active analysis and monitoring, and a third on policy
expertise and community education.

Concretely, you will be responsible for:

   - Conducting network penetration testing, application vulnerability
   assessments, risk analysis, and compliance testing
   - Using Linux and Windows command-line tools (Powershell, Grep, AWK,
   etc.) to analyze and respond to security incidents
   - Using or learning to use information security tools such as Wireshark,
   ArcSight, Bro, Cloudlock, Splunk, Metasploit, Snort, Nessus, Nikto, Nmap,
   WMIC, AppLocker, McAfee ePO, Symantec ESM, etc.
   - Leading the technical aspects of investigations
   - Parsing and querying bro logs and correlating log and network data
   - Recommending firewall, GPO, and other security infrastructure and
   policy changes in partnership with each college’s systems administration
   team
